C. Hildebrand has authored 120 papers that have received a total of 3.5k indexed citations.
This includes 64 papers in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ience, 37 papers in Molecular Biology and 33 papers in Developmental Neuroscience. The topics of these papers are Nerve injury and regeneration (38 papers), Neurogenesis and neuroplasticity mechanisms (33 papers) and Neuropeptides and Animal Physiology (21 papers). C. Hildebrand is often cited by papers focused on Nerve injury and regeneration (38 papers), Neurogenesis and neuroplasticity mechanisms (33 papers) and Neuropeptides and Animal Physiology (21 papers) and collaborates with scholars based in Sweden, United States and Portugal. C. Hildebrand's co-authors include Kaj Fried, Mårten Risling, S. Remahl, Carl Bjartmar and Stephen G. Waxman and has published in prestigious journals such as The Journal of Comparative Neurology, Brain Research and Neuroscience.
